The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Sandwell local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 186 OLDBURY ROAD sales from May 2014 and August 2015 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the May 2014 sale was for 4%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 4% above the HPI over time, until the August 2015 sale, where it rises to 17%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 17% above the HPI.
186 OLDBURY ROAD might now be worth an estimated £368,673.
This is based on house price inflation of 73.9%, between August 2015 and February 2025, for detached houses, in the Sandwell local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).
